Enough I hear you shout of the embossed Joyful Christmas flower on the vellum but hey, I love it don’t you? Plus, look what I did with the combination of thankful and merry Expressions Thinlit Dies – I created thanks. There is no ‘S’ in any of the three words hence needed to create one.

Hmmm, that tested the old grey matter and after only one false start, discovered if the Silver Foil was placed upside-down onto the second ‘R’ in merry which was then turned upside-down once created, a ‘S’ is born. It does the job.

Preparing for a workshop last week which was focusing on heat embossing, I had the best time creating. I just couldn’t decide what design would be best so kept creating until it “felt” right.

This was one of my first creations. I just love how the silver embossing is so striking on the white vellum cardstock which I’ve then mounted on the silver glimmer paper. Of course, just a smidge of Cherry Cobbler always adds to the Christmas feel with the sentiment from Sassy Salutations finishing it off nicely!

Joyful Christmas - Silver - JIF

Having made the card in silver and white, I couldn’t resist trying it in a combination of Very Vanilla and Gold Embossing. The red this time was the red glimmer paper behind the flowers that had been fussy cut and mounted upon it. Aren’t my gold “balls” just the best, lol? I was determined to have gold balls in the center of my flower so I bunched up a mini glue-dot and doused it with gold glitter!

Joyful Christmas - Red - JIF

The final design used for the “Make & Take” was a combination of the two cards with Very Vanilla as the base but using Silver and Cherry Cobbler. The Frosted Finishes Embellishment completing the fussy-cut flowers perfectly.  At first I was concerned it may have been a tad plain but I’m relieved to say the ladies were MORE than happy with it, making me EXTREMELY happy! 😉
